Physical Techniques for Lasting Longer
Exercise Your Pelvic Floor
Your pelvic muscles play a crucial role in controlling sexual activity. Regularly performing Kegel exercises can strengthen these muscles, giving you better control over ejaculation. By tightening and relaxing these muscles, you can help extend your sexual performance.
Get Active with Cardiovascular Workouts
Improving your stamina isn't just about your pelvic muscles. Cardiovascular exercises, such as running, swimming, or cycling, boost overall stamina. These exercises enhance circulation, reduce fatigue, and increase energy levels, all of which help improve endurance in bed.

Understanding the Root Causes of Premature Climax
Premature climax, or premature ejaculation (PE), is a concern for many individuals, and it can significantly impact one’s confidence and relationship dynamics. It occurs when a person ejaculates sooner than they, or their partner, would prefer. Understanding the underlying causes of premature climax can help address the issue more effectively. Several factors can contribute to this condition, from psychological factors to physical conditions. Identifying the root cause is the first step toward improvement.
Psychological Factors Behind Premature Climax
Performance Anxiety and Stress
One of the most common psychological contributors to premature climax is performance anxiety. If you’re constantly worried about not being able to "perform," this stress can lead to premature ejaculation. The pressure to satisfy your partner or meet certain expectations can cause your nervous system to react quickly, triggering early ejaculation. Learning to manage these feelings through relaxation and mindfulness techniques can help alleviate the issue.
Depression and Mental Health
Mental health issues, such as depression, can also be linked to premature climax. Depression often affects libido and can lead to difficulties in sexual function. When someone is feeling mentally low, it can be harder to stay present during intimacy, which may contribute to a quicker climax. Addressing mental health through therapy, medication, or other coping mechanisms can help in reducing the frequency of premature climax episodes.
Physical Factors That Contribute to Premature Climax
Hormonal Imbalances
Hormonal fluctuations, especially those involving testosterone, can affect sexual function. Lower levels of testosterone can reduce stamina, increase sensitivity, and potentially lead to premature ejaculation. If a person has an imbalance in their hormones, such as high levels of prolactin or low testosterone, it may affect how quickly they climax. Hormone therapy or natural supplements may help, but it’s essential to get tested to determine if hormones are the culprit.
Neurobiological Factors
The nervous system plays a critical role in the timing of ejaculation. Some individuals may have a heightened sensitivity in their genital area, leading to a faster response. This can result from an overactive sympathetic nervous system, which may trigger ejaculation more quickly than expected. A healthcare provider can assess nerve function and provide strategies to manage this condition, such as specific exercises or medications.

Breathing Techniques to Enhance Sexual Control
Deep Breathing for Relaxation
One of the most effective ways to manage sexual performance is through controlled breathing. Deep breathing techniques can help you relax and reduce anxiety, which are often contributors to premature ejaculation. Slow, deep breaths activate the parasympathetic nervous system, encouraging your body to relax and easing the tension that may lead to an early climax.
The key is to focus on long, steady breaths that fill the lungs completely. Inhale deeply through your nose for about four seconds, hold the breath for a moment, and then exhale slowly through your mouth for six seconds. This rhythm helps calm the nervous system and can improve overall control during intimacy. Practicing this technique regularly, both in and out of the bedroom, will help you gain greater mastery over your responses.
The "Pause and Breathe" Method
In situations where you feel close to climaxing too soon, the "pause and breathe" technique can be a game changer. When you feel the sensation of impending climax, stop moving and take a deep breath. Pause for a few moments while focusing on your breathing, allowing the sensations to subside. This simple act can help reduce sexual tension and allow you to regain control before continuing. This technique may take practice but can be highly effective once mastered.
Using Breathing to Reduce Hyperstimulation
Hyperstimulation, or feeling overwhelmed by intense sensations, can lead to premature climax. By using controlled breathing to reduce hyperstimulation, you can better manage the sexual experience. When you feel overwhelmed, take slow, deep breaths to lower the intensity of the sensations and re-center your focus. The act of slowing your breath helps slow down the entire experience, giving you more time to enjoy intimacy at a comfortable pace.
